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> IT форум > Помощь студентам
Регистрация

Восстановить пароль

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 02.06.2010, 15:17   #1
Горящее сердце
 
Регистрация: 16.05.2010
Сообщений: 8
По умолчанию Одномерный массив

Посмотрите пожалуйста 5 вариант!!!!
Вложения
Тип файла: doc ЛБ № 8 Одном.массивы.DOC (74.5 Кб, 15 просмотров)
Горящее сердце вне форума Ответить с цитированием
Старый 02.06.2010, 15:48   #2
RUSt88
Участник клуба
 
Регистрация: 29.12.2009
Сообщений: 1,166
По умолчанию

могу выполнить за вознаграждение
прогер C\C++\C#\Delphi
ася: [семь 3]-[97]-[1 шесть]
RUSt88 вне форума Ответить с цитированием
Старый 02.06.2010, 15:55   #3
DoDge_VipeR
Форумчанин
 
Аватар для DoDge_VipeR
 
Регистрация: 30.04.2010
Сообщений: 317
По умолчанию

Код:
for i:=1 to n do 
if (5-3*q[i]>0) then write(q[i]:6);
тьфу это ж 8)))
icq:627719[сто сорок четыре] - помогу с Pascal & Delphi!

Последний раз редактировалось DoDge_VipeR; 02.06.2010 в 16:30.
DoDge_VipeR вне форума Ответить с цитированием
Старый 02.06.2010, 16:19   #4
Ol'ga_new
Форумчанин
 
Регистрация: 12.05.2010
Сообщений: 125
По умолчанию

Думаю должно получиться (это 5 вариант):
Код:
function st(k:word):integer;
var i:word;
begin
i:=2;
z:=2
if k>1 then
while i<=k do
begin
z:=z*2;
i:=inc(i);
end;
st:=z;
end;

function fakt(k:word):integer;
var i:word;
begin
for i:=1 to k do
  fakt:=fakt*i;
end;

.....

for k:=1 to n do
 if (a[k]>st(k)) and (a[k]<fakt(k)) then
    kol:=inc(kol);
....
в переменной kol-количество чисел в последовательности удовлетворяющих условию!
Ol'ga_new вне форума Ответить с цитированием
Старый 02.06.2010, 16:30   #5
DoDge_VipeR
Форумчанин
 
Аватар для DoDge_VipeR
 
Регистрация: 30.04.2010
Сообщений: 317
По умолчанию

вот 5 вариант)
Код:
col:=0;
st2:=2;
f:=1;
for i:=1 to n do
begin
if (a[i]>st2) and (a[i]<f) then col:=col+1;
st2:=st2*2;
f:=f*i;
end;
icq:627719[сто сорок четыре] - помогу с Pascal & Delphi!
DoDge_VipeR вне форума Ответить с цитированием
Старый 02.06.2010, 18:42   #6
RUSt88
Участник клуба
 
Регистрация: 29.12.2009
Сообщений: 1,166
По умолчанию

Цитата:
kol:=inc(kol);
не, я понимаю, что программист может все, но чтобы так..
прогер C\C++\C#\Delphi
ася: [семь 3]-[97]-[1 шесть]
RUSt88 в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Одномерный массив Gaia Паскаль, Turbo Pascal, PascalABC.NET 2 18.05.2010 15:56
одномерный массив... Ole4ka Помощь студентам 5 17.05.2010 22:01
Одномерный массив. Q basic - Построить новый массив из элементов исходного ,которые больше P. Marishkaa Помощь студентам 2 12.01.2010 16:54
Двумерный массив, одномерный массив. Branbal Помощь студентам 14 18.11.2009 12:40
Одномерный массив xxxPascalxxx Помощь студентам 3 18.01.2009 15:23